    Would this be worth fixing up?

    First of all, hello everyone! I'm new to the forum, I found this place because after seeing an ad on craigslist for a z1000 that didn't have a front end, I was looking at what swaps were possible. Currently I only own a Ninja 250ex but hope to step things up a bit pretty soon.

    So that brings me to my question... would this 2003 z1000 be worth fixing up? The guy on craigslist wants $500 for it. The body is damage free and the motor appears to be intact... the guy is claiming not to have a key or DMV papers, saying he got it "through a lien sale at a storage auction". That kind of scares me and who knows what kind of fees it will have (not to mention getting a key made probably cost $200) and I wont be able to hear the bike turn on before buying it.

    It seems like most everyone does a 636 swap on these bikes anyways, so it's not a total loss that the forks are gone.

    Hopefully someone could give me some more insight... should I just walk away from this train wreck? Or turn it in to something nice? Thank you very much in advance!

    I'd get the VIN first, run it to the sheriff dept and make sure it's not stolen or any lien on it.

    If not, I'd go for it at that price. If the frame is straight, you're good to go. Get you a new new Z1000 triple, pretty much a whole 636 front end. Z1000 headlight and parts. I think you can come out with a nicely upgraded Z for less than 2K. If you can find a lot of parts on ebay and used that is.

    The title part, as long as there's no lien, you can get a bonded title for a hundred bucks worth of paperwork. Easy peasy. Search for Bonded title on here. I did mine, dont remember the exact steps, but it took about a week.

    Look for flaking paint on the frame around the steering head and back at least 12 inches.
